AGREEMENT FOR MAINTENANCE <br />OF TRAFFIC CONTROL SIGNALS <br />AGREEMENT NO. PW2013-08 <br />THIS AGREEMENT, made and entered into by and between the County of Ramsey, <br />("County,") and the City of Mounds View ("City") for the installation and maintenance of a <br />traffic control signal system with street lights, signs, interconnect, and emergency vehicle pre- <br />emption at the intersection of C.S.A.H. 10 (CSAH 10) and Silver Lake Road (CSAR 44)/Red <br />Oak Drive; <br />WHEREAS, the County has determined that there is justification and it is in the public's <br />best interest to install a new traffic control signal with street lights, signs, interconnect, and <br />emergency vehicle pre-emption at C.S.A.H. 10 (CSAR 10) and Silver Lake Road (CSAR <br />44)/Red Oak Drive; and <br />WHEREAS, the City requested and the County agrees to an Emergency Vehicle Pre-emption <br />System, hereinafter referred to as the "EVP System" as a part of said traffic control signal with street <br />lights in accordance with the terms and conditions hereinafter set forth; and <br />WHEREAS, the County and the City will participate in the maintenance and operation of said <br />traffic control signal with street lights, signs, interconnect, and EVP system as hereinafter set forth. <br />NOW, THEREFORE, IT IS AGREED AS FOLLOWS: <br />1. The County shall install or cause the installation of said traffic control signal with street lights, <br />signs, interconnect, and EVP system in accordance with the plan and specification for S.P. 062-610- <br />003, S.P. 062-644-033, S.P. 146-228-007, County Project P3234. <br />2, The City shall install or cause the installation of an adequate electric power supply to the <br />service pad including any necessary extensions of power lines. Upon completion of the traffic control <br />signal with street lights, signs, interconnect, and EVP system installation, necessary electrical power for <br />their operation shall be at the cost and expense of the City. In accordance with the Policy for lighting <br />County Roadways, County Board Resolution 78-1394, the City shall maintain and pay energy costs of <br />the integral street lights. <br />3. Upon completion of the work the County shall maintain and keep in repair the traffic control <br />signal including relamping and cleaning at the County's expense. <br />4. Upon completion of the work the County shall maintain and keep in repair the interconnect and <br />overhead mast arm mounted signs at the County's expense. <br />5. The County shall maintain and keep in repair the geometries on County -owned roadways at <br />the County's expense. The City shall maintain and keep in repair the geometries on City -owned <br />roads at the City's expense. <br />PW 2013-08 Page 1 of 4 <br />
